Second novel in his Reykjavik mysteries. As amazing as the first one. A dark tale of abuse, of courage and ultimately of resilience. Erlendur must deal with his daughter in a profound coma, the discovery of a skeleton in the suburbs of Reykjavik where the second World War Army base was situated starts a trip down memory lane and the search for a woman in green, a lost fiancée and in the end the naked truth. Deep, disturbing but wonderful.
